Top 5 Best Fulton County Public High Schools (2025)

For the 2025 school year, there are 8 public high schools serving 3,142 students in Fulton County, OH.
The top ranked public high schools in Fulton County, OH are Archbold High School, Evergreen High School and Pettisville High School. Overall testing rank is based on a school's combined math and reading proficiency test score ranking.
Fulton County, OH public high schools have an average math proficiency score of 62% (versus the Ohio public high school average of 40%), and reading proficiency score of 74% (versus the 57% statewide average). High schools in Fulton County have an average ranking of 10/10, which is in the top 10% of Ohio public high schools.
Fulton County, OH public high school have a Graduation Rate of 91%, which is more than the Ohio average of 86%.
The school with highest graduation rate is Archbold High School, with ≥95% graduation rate. Read more about public school graduation rate statistics in Ohio or national school graduation rate statistics.
Minority enrollment is 16% of the student body (majority Hispanic), which is less than the Ohio public high school average of 33% (majority Black).
